Delve into advanced strategies of customer service management and unravel the intricacies of the customer journey roadmap. Familiarize yourself with the tenets of customer charters and gain a profound understanding of who your customers truly are. Offer services meticulously tailored to meet your customer's desires and pinpoint the gaps in the customer journey that can lead to potential frustrations, ensuring a seamless experience every step of the way.


Designed for individuals who have completed the Introduction to Customer Service course, have experience in events and festivals, and/or work in a supervisory role. This workshop will challenge attendees to view and see customer service in a different and more challenging way!
